Etymology: Ompok: It is a bad reproduction of a Malayam fish name as limpok/ompok (Ref. 45335).

Freshwater; brackish; demersal. Tropical
Asia: Chao Phraya to Mekong basins.

Occurs in mainstreams, tributaries and marshlands (Ref. 58784). A carnivorous species which feeds on crustaceans and insects (Ref. 58784).
